What Is a Battery-Free Locking Solution?
A battery-free locking solution is an advanced access control system that operates without internal batteries by harvesting energy from ambient sources or user interactions. These systems typically utilize two core technologies:
1. NFC Energy Harvesting
By utilizing the electromagnetic field generated by a smartphone or NFC credential, energy is harvested to power the smart lock electronics. For example, Infineon's NFC energy-harvesting chip can draw 20–50 mW from the phone's NFC field, providing sufficient power to unlock the mechanism—no physical keys, codes, or battery replacements required.

2. Kinetic Energy Harvesting
Our electronic passive locks convert mechanical motion—such as inserting and turning an electronic key—into electrical energy. This "1 key to manage 10,000 locks" approach offers a robust, wire-free solution for industrial applications where connectivity is limited.
Key Insight: Battery-free locks eliminate the need for battery replacements, avoiding downtime and reducing labor costs while preventing issues caused by insufficient battery power, such as lock malfunctions.

Why Industries Are Switching to Battery-Free Smart Locks
Zero Maintenance Costs
Traditional electronic locks require regular battery replacements, leading to significant ongoing expenses and operational disruptions. Battery-free locks are maintenance-free from day one. Once installed, they operate indefinitely without technician callouts, battery purchases, or disposal logistics.
